Alert: sdk-parity-drift (warning)

Fires when the nightly parity audit finds the Quillfox JavaScript SDK and the Quillfox Go SDK diverging on more than three public API surfaces. Current trigger: the Go SDK lacks streaming upload and token refresh hooks shipped in JS 4.2. Impact is limited to partners on the Go beta channel. Parity gaps are tracked on the Quillfox board; drift must close before GA. Route questions raised at the sync to the address below.

alerts address for bawif-hahig: norwyn_gorys_lamath@olvarqlabs.test

Runbook: search relevance tuning (Findlet). Before each release, rerun the golden-query suite and eyeball the top-20 diffs — synonym weights in the Brackish index drift more than you'd expect. If NDCG drops over 2%, hold the release and ping the ranking crew. The full tuning notes and current weight table live at the page below.

wiki page, tahaf-tajog: https://jira.ordindyn.corp/pipeline

## Deployment

The Taxgrove rate-lookup cache ships as a sidecar alongside the Ledgerline API. Before the weekly sync, confirm that the cache warms from the regional rate snapshot and that stale entries expire within the agreed window; a cold cache can double lookup latency for the first ten minutes. Roll out one zone at a time and watch hit ratios. The sidecar reads the following configuration at startup.

config for tagep-yajef:
ulawyn:
  log_level: error
  metrics_host: metrics.ulawyn.lumiclabs.internal
  pin: 0564
  pool_size: 32